What we actually do

CRE Radar monitors publicly available commercial listing pages across brokerage websites, aggregators, landlord pages, and public portals. When a new listing appears or an existing one changes, we send an alert to the professional who set up that filter.

We don't host listings. We don't publish a public marketplace. We don't redirect client relationships. We're a workflow tool that helps commercial real estate professionals stay current on a fragmented market, faster than manual checking allows.

Every listing CRE Radar monitors is already publicly visible on your website. We surface it to subscribers, then send them directly to you.

How every listing is displayed

Every listing card in CRE Radar is built around three commitments to source attribution:

  • Brokerage branding: The source brokerage name and logo appear on every listing card. Your brand stays visible throughout the workflow.
  • Clear source labelling: Every card shows exactly where the listing came from, the brokerage site, aggregator, or portal it originated on.
  • Direct link to original: Every listing links directly back to the original listing page on your website. Traffic goes to you, not to us.
